I John Adams being of sound minde and memory blessed be to God for his mercys (sic)...Imprimis; I give unto the heirs of sone (sic) Thomas Adams, six shillings each...[to] my beloved wife, Sarah...all the lands which I holde (sic)...[to] my son, William Adams, shall have all the lands adjoining Mark Anthony [up to] the line of the land I made my son, James a Wright (sic)...my will is that all my personal estate shall be sold and the money arising from such sales shall be equally divided amongst my children, herein after named to wit:

  • Imprimis; I give to Winnifred Thomas one equal part of such sales;
  • ... unto my daughter Polly DALTON one equal part of such sale
  • ... unto my daughter Peggy Leftwich one equal part
  • ... unto my daughter Sarah Weeks one equal part
  • ... also I give unto my son John Adams one equal part
  • ... also one equal part unto my daughter Sarah Leftwich
  • ... Milly Adams one equal part of such sale
  • ... and lastly I hereby constitute my son William Adams and my son
  • James Adams my executors to this my last will and testament.
  • Written 8 Jun 1818, proved 25 Nov 1824 Bedford Co. VA

James was baptised 22 January 1711[1] in Honington, Warwickshire. He was the son of Henry and Mary Adams.

James Adams, the progenitor of the Adams of The Fork, Richland County, South Carolina, came as an emigrant from England to Virginia prior to 1746. He married Agnes Walker, daughter of Henry Walker, and they had two sons. After the death of James Adams, Agnes married a Culpepper and is said to have had two daughters by this marriage .

Children

  1. John Adams Jr. Born 1749 in Bedford, Virginia. Husband of Sarah Ann (Snow) Adams — married about 1775 in Virginia
  2. Joel Adams Sr. Born 4 Feb 1750 in Culpepper, Virginia. Husband of Grace (Weston) Adams — married 28 Dec 1773 in Congaree, Lower Richland County, South Carolina
